L'Île Bavarde - streets of Lieurey (Upper Normandy).
Explore "L'Île Bavarde" on the map of Lieurey in street view mode
Click on the buttons below to display the map of L'Île Bavarde, Lieurey, France
Tags:
L'Île Bavarde on the map of Lieurey,
Lieurey satellite view, Lieurey street view.